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Garston (Hertfordshire) to Alderley Edge start from as little as £34.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Garston (Hertfordshire) to Alderley Edge start from £73.50 one way, or £105.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Garston (Hertfordshire) to Alderley Edge are available for £157.50 one way, or £315.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

While Garston station is relatively small, it provides several essential facilities to ensure a comfortable journey. Although there isn't a ticket office, passengers can conveniently collect purchased tickets from the available ticket machines. However, it's worth noting that these machines are not accessible for those requiring assistance, as accessible options are unfortunately not available.

If you require help or need information, there are help points located on the station platforms. However, there is no staff assistance available directly at the station. For more comprehensive support, you can contact the dedicated helpline, available to ensure that everyone journeys with ease and confidence.

Accessibility at Garston station is thoughtfully designed, with step-free access across the platform areas, making it ideal for passengers with mobility challenges. Unlike some larger stations, Garston does not have amenities like waiting rooms, retail outlets, or refreshment facilities, so planning ahead is recommended for a more comfortable travel experience.

Facilities at Alderley Edge Station

The station provides essential facilities for travelers, ensuring a comfortable journey. The ticket office operates from early morning until early afternoon on Saturdays, though it remains closed during weekdays and Sundays. However, you can still purchase tickets or collect pre-purchased tickets from the accessible ticket machines located on-site. It's worth noting that smartcards are supported at the station, aligning with modern, streamlined travel conveniences.

For those with specific accessibility needs, Alderley Edge station offers partial step-free access and is categorized as a scooter-friendly location, making it navigable for those using mobility aids. There's no waiting room available, yet the station ensures passenger security with the presence of CCTV. Unfortunately, facilities such as restrooms, baby changing rooms, and refreshment outlets are not provided, so plan accordingly.
